US President Donald Trump signed a decree imposing an additional duty of 25% on goods from India. This was announced today, August 6, according to the White House website.
The White House said that the total duties from the United States for India will be 50%, as well as for Brazil. The additional mark-up on goods for India is related to the purchase of Russian oil, the statement said.
"Goods from India imported into the customs territory of the United States are subject to an additional duty of 25%... This rate applies to goods received for consumption or removed from the warehouse for consumption at 00.01 Eastern Summer Time (07.00 Moscow Time) or after that date 21 days after the date of this order," it says. in the document.
